Narcissists Attack
ナルシー攻撃 Narushī Kōgeki
Unite Information
Range
All enemies
Damage
0.5x
Effect
Silence (30% chance) if player has obtained the Rose Bouquet item.
The Narcissists Attack (ナルシー攻撃, Narushī Kōgeki) is a Unite Attack in Suikoden II. It was called the Narcissus Attack in the 1999 English localization of Suikoden II.
Information
This unite attack was used by the dear friends, Simone Verdricci and Vincent de Boule. Roses, a testimony to their gentlemanly spirit, would fall from the sky and then the duo would attack all enemies simultaneously while they were bewildered by their elegance.
The Rose Bouquet would further strengthen the attack by potentially rendering the surviving enemies speechless.
